Just a quick answer to a question about aging done in my We layout. I aged the library card dividers using a VersaMagic ink pad in a dark brown. They are those little droplet shaped pads and I really like working with them. On a lighter note, they smell nice too!

This is mostly Cosmo Cricket products, with a bit cardstock. It is a a little peek at Gabby’s 6th birthday party. It was interesting to use the large chipboard pieces. I do get these in kits from time to time and this is Label Tulips June kit. I usually struggle to use these items until I applied some information found at Balzer Designs. I just left the pieces alone on the page.
I am struggling to get my head around some parts of scrapbooking. I have a hard time judging what is “good.” I understand basic design principles, but some of the details elude me. When I actually go into a scrapbooking store I come out with almost nothing. All of the ornaments seem expensive or impractical.
I have to admit that is why I love kit clubs. I have so many things that I would never have purchased alone. It is a challenge to use really cool pieces well. It has changed my perspective on decoration in art and life. 🙂
